Advanced Tips for Choosing the Best Unique Dog Names
- Consider Your Dog's Personality: Observe your dog's behavior and quirks. A name that reflects your dog's unique traits can create a stronger bond.
- Test the Name: Call your dog by the new name in various situations. See if they respond positively or seem confused. A name that elicits a reaction can be a good choice.
- Think About Future Context: Your dog's name will be heard in various settings, like at the dog park or vet's office. Choose a name that is easy to call out and doesn't sound like common commands.
- Get Creative with Spelling: If you love a traditional name, consider unique spellings. This can give a classic name a fresh twist while still being recognizable.
- Include Family Input: Involve family members in the naming process. This helps ensure everyone feels connected to the name and can help avoid conflicts later.

What should I avoid when choosing a unique dog name?
Avoid names that sound too similar to common commands like 'Sit' or 'Stay', as this can confuse your dog. Additionally, steer clear of overly complicated names that are hard to pronounce or remember. A unique name should still be easy for you and your dog to recognize.
Can I change my dog's name after adopting them?
Yes, it's possible to change your dog's name after adoption. Start by using the new name consistently and pairing it with treats or praise to help your dog learn it. Be patient, as it may take time for them to adjust to their new name.
How do I know if a unique name is a good fit for my dog?
A good fit for a unique name will often depend on how your dog responds to it. Try calling your dog by the name and observe their reaction. If they seem to respond positively and look at you, it’s likely a good match.
